Analyst II, Business (Marine)


American Bureau of Shipping (ABS)


Location

Pune | India


Job description

Job Description

We are looking for Naval Architect/Marine Engineer as a Business Analyst II with experience in Ship Plan approval or verification process OR marine classification services such as surveying or construction overseeing activities OR ship design and construction with emphasis on dealing with classification services.

The candidate should be willing to work with SMEs (ABS Surveyors & Engineers) and various other stakeholders to understand the business needs and requirements, product use cases and translate them to meaningful and relatable requirements. Candidate will also require close interaction on a day-to-day basis with a software development team comprising Developers, QA Analysts, and other actors to help them understand, design, develop and implement various product solutions as per the business needs.

About Us

We set out more than 160 years ago to promote the security of life and property at sea and preserve the natural environment. Today, we remain true to our mission and continue to support organizations facing a rapidly evolving seascape of challenging regulations and new technologies. Through it all, we are anchored by a vision and mission that help our clients find clarity in uncertain times.

ABS is a global leader in marine and offshore classification and other innovative safety, quality, and environmental services. We're at the forefront of supporting the global energy transition at sea, the application of remote and autonomous marine systems, cutting-edge technical solutions, and many more exciting advancements. Our commitment to safety, reliability, and efficiency is ever-present, guiding our clients to safer and more efficient operations.
